Recycled newspaper hand spun on drop spindles into a variable width yarn between 2 and 4 mm. The Indian newspapers are rescued from landfill, torn into strips and spun by countryside co-operatives to supplement low incomes. Each length of yarn (approximately 40 metres / 100g) is completely unique and can be knitted or woven into a paper fabric. Use to wrap around glass jars and glue with PVA or roll into a coil and set in resin!
Due to the nature of the material it is not possible to wash Recycled Newspaper Yarn
